The Master of Science [M.Sc.] in Hotel Management at Career Point University (CPU), Hamirpur, Himachal Pradesh, is a two-year, four-semester postgraduate programme in advanced hospitality and hotel management. The curriculum covers hotel operations strategy, revenue management, food and beverage management, hospitality marketing, research methods, and entrepreneurship in hospitality, complemented by an industry project. CPU is UGC-approved and holds NAAC B-grade accreditation. Total fees for the two-year programme are ₹1,57,000, payable at ₹38,000 per semester over four semesters plus a one-time admission fee of ₹5,000.

Eligibility Criteria
- Candidates must hold a bachelor’s degree from a recognised university in any discipline with at least 50 percent marks (45 percent for SC/ST candidates).
- Graduates in hotel management, hospitality, tourism, catering, or related disciplines are preferred but candidates from other streams are also eligible.
Admission Process
- Register on the admissions portal at admission.cpuh.in and complete the M.Sc. Hotel Management application form.
- Appear for NCHM M.Sc. JEE, CUET-PG, HPCET (PG), or CPU-EST; or apply for direct merit admission based on graduation marks.
- Receive merit list and admission offer based on entrance score or graduation percentage.
- Complete document verification at the university campus.
- Pay the one-time admission fee and first-semester fees to confirm the seat.
CPU M.Sc. Hotel Management Scholarships 2026
M.Sc. Hotel Management Scholarships Available
| Scholarship | Amount | Eligibility |
| CPU-EST Merit Scholarship | Up to 90% on tuition fee | Based on performance in the CPU Eligibility and Scholarship Test (CPU-EST) |
| JEE Main / Class XII Merit Scholarship | 10% to 50% on tuition fee | Based on JEE Main percentile or Class XII aggregate marks |
| Post-Matric Scholarship (GoI/GoHP) | Full to partial fee coverage | SC/ST students from Himachal Pradesh; annual family income as per scheme norms |
| NSP Central Sector Scholarship | ₹12,000 per year | Top 20 percent in qualifying examination; family income below ₹8,00,000 |
- Merit scholarships earned through the CPU-EST apply to all semesters provided the student maintains satisfactory academic performance.
- If eligible for both CPU-EST and JEE Main/XII merit scholarships, the higher scholarship amount is applied.
- Government scholarship applications should be submitted on the National Scholarship Portal at scholarships.gov.in within the annual window (typically August to October).
